The word "mesocoelic" is derived from a combination of roots that are common in anatomical terminology. The prefix "meso-" comes from the Greek word for "middle," while "-coelic" relates to the coelom, which is a fluid-filled body cavity found in many organisms. Therefore, "mesocoelic" can be understood to mean "pertaining to the middle coelom." This term is particularly relevant when discussing the anatomy of certain organisms or developmental stages in embryology.
